About the Role

Hive is an innovative employee feedback platform and strategic HR partnership dedicated to helping companies manage change and amplify employee voice through a blend of accessible cloud-based technology and expert coaching. We are currently seeking a highly organized, proactive, and discreet Executive Assistant to serve as the operational backbone for our Founders in Nigeria. In this role, you will own complex calendar management, coordinate high-stakes meetings, and handle sensitive business matters with absolute confidentiality. You will act as a crucial force multiplier, keeping our leadership team focused on scaling our operations and driving meaningful impact across the African tech ecosystem.

Key Responsibilities
  • Own the Founders' calendars end-to-end, strategically prioritizing meetings, focus time, and personal appointments while managing last-minute changes across multiple time zones.
  • Prepare meeting agendas, take comprehensive minutes, and track follow-up actions to ensure seamless communication between internal teams and external stakeholders including investors and partners.
  • Handle special projects that extend beyond traditional administrative responsibilities, such as in-depth research, document preparation, and cross-functional task coordination.
  • Facilitate prompt, clear, and professional communication between executive leadership and all organizational levels, acting as a reliable gatekeeper and brand ambassador.

Qualifications
  • Minimum of 3 years of professional experience supporting C-level executives or founders, preferably within a fast-paced startup or technology environment.
  • Exceptional organizational skills with a proven ability to manage complex, shifting priorities under tight deadlines and high-pressure situations.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, coupled with uncompromised discretion and sound professional judgment.
  • Proficiency in modern productivity tools such as Google Workspace, Notion, and Slack, alongside a strong willingness to leverage AI tools for workflow automation.
  • A proactive self-starter mindset with the ability to anticipate needs before they arise and thrive in ambiguous, rapidly changing environments.
